Sales Funnel: AIDA

A sales funnel is a conceptual framework that represents the customer’s journey from initial awareness of a product or service to the final conversion or purchase. It visualizes the stages that potential customers go through, highlighting the process of gradually moving them from being aware of a brand to becoming loyal customers. The metaphor of a funnel is used because, as the journey progresses, the number of potential customers typically decreases, resembling the narrowing shape of a funnel.

The sales funnel is typically divided into several stages:

Awareness

At the top of the funnel, potential customers become aware of a product or service through various marketing channels, such as social media, advertising, or content marketing.

Interest

In this stage, potential customers show interest by engaging with the brand’s content, visiting the website, or signing up for newsletters.

Desire

As customers continue down the funnel, their interest evolves into desire as they explore the benefits and solutions offered by the product or service. This stage involves evaluating options and comparing them with competitors.

Action

The bottom of the funnel is where the conversion occurs. This could be a purchase, signing up for a service, or any other desired action that signifies the customer’s commitment.

Online Sales Funnels Are Good For Business

An online sales funnel is a structured framework that guides potential customers through a series of stages, from initial awareness to eventual conversion, with the ultimate goal of driving sales and revenue. Implementing an online sales funnel offers several compelling advantages for businesses seeking to maximize their success in the digital marketplace:

Streamlined Customer Journey

An online sales funnel provides a clear and well-defined path for customers, eliminating confusion and ensuring a seamless progression from awareness to purchase. This organized approach enhances user experience, reducing the likelihood of drop-offs and abandoned carts.

Targeted Engagement

By segmenting and targeting different stages of the funnel, businesses can deliver highly relevant content and messaging to specific audience segments. This personalized approach increases the chances of resonating with potential customers, effectively nurturing their interest and driving them closer to conversion.

Lead Generation and Qualification

The funnel’s structure enables businesses to capture leads at various touchpoints, allowing for the collection of valuable contact information. Through strategic nurturing and engagement, these leads can be further qualified, identifying those with genuine interest and potential for conversion.

Data-Driven Decision Making

An online sales funnel generates valuable data insights at each stage, enabling businesses to analyze customer behavior, preferences, and pain points. This data-driven approach empowers informed decision-making, facilitating iterative improvements to the funnel and marketing strategies.

Increased Conversion Rates

By systematically guiding potential customers through the funnel and addressing their specific needs, businesses can enhance their chances of converting leads into paying customers. The funnel’s focus on nurturing and education builds trust and credibility, contributing to higher conversion rates.

Efficient Resource Allocation

Online sales funnels allow businesses to allocate resources more efficiently by tailoring their efforts based on the stage of the customer journey. This targeted approach optimizes marketing spend and efforts, ensuring maximum impact and return on investment.

Scalability and Automation

Once established, an online sales funnel can be automated to a significant extent. Automated email sequences, personalized recommendations, and follow-up messages can be triggered based on user actions, enabling businesses to scale their reach without proportional increases in manual effort.

Long-Term Customer Relationships

An effective sales funnel doesn’t end at the point of sale; it continues to nurture and engage customers post-purchase. By delivering ongoing value, relevant content, and exceptional customer support, businesses can foster lasting relationships, driving customer loyalty and repeat business.

Adaptability to Changing Trends

Online sales funnels can be adjusted and optimized in response to evolving market trends, customer preferences, and competitive landscapes. This adaptability ensures that businesses remain agile and well-positioned to capture opportunities and navigate challenges.

Competitive Advantage

Implementing a well-designed online sales funnel sets businesses apart by offering a customer-centric approach. This competitive advantage can lead to increased market share, brand recognition, and overall profitability.
